#36233E Color Information

Hex color code: #36233E

#36233E is a dark purple color. In RGB it is (54, 35, 62), and in HSL it is (282°, 28%, 19%). It is often used for branding and logos.

Color Meaning and Usage

A deep purple tone, #36233E has RGB (54, 35, 62) and HSL (282°, 28%, 19%). Known for evoking sophistication and elegance, this very dark shade is a solid option for clean and minimal interfaces. Lighter variations like #FFFFFF create softer gradients.

The complementary color of #36233E is #2B3E23, creating high-contrast pairings. For softer combinations, try analogous colors like #28233E.
